基于dm642的紙幣識別系統(tǒng)的設(shè)計與實現(xiàn)

基于dm642的紙幣識別系統(tǒng)的設(shè)計與實現(xiàn)

ID:24374451

大?。?0.50 KB

頁數(shù):4頁

時間:2018-11-14

基于dm642的紙幣識別系統(tǒng)的設(shè)計與實現(xiàn)_第1頁
基于dm642的紙幣識別系統(tǒng)的設(shè)計與實現(xiàn)_第2頁
基于dm642的紙幣識別系統(tǒng)的設(shè)計與實現(xiàn)_第3頁
基于dm642的紙幣識別系統(tǒng)的設(shè)計與實現(xiàn)_第4頁
資源描述:

《基于dm642的紙幣識別系統(tǒng)的設(shè)計與實現(xiàn)》由會員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在工程資料-天天文庫

1、基于DM642的紙幣識別系統(tǒng)的設(shè)計與實現(xiàn)本文介紹了一種基于TI的DM642平臺的紙幣識別系統(tǒng)的硬件設(shè)計及對應(yīng)的識別方法。在硬件設(shè)計上,將高速數(shù)字信號處理(DSP)技術(shù)與可編程邏輯門陣列(FPGA)和接觸式圖像傳感器(CIS)相結(jié)合;在識別方法上,應(yīng)用圖像處理技術(shù)與模式匹配算法相結(jié)合識別紙幣。實驗證明,此系統(tǒng)達(dá)到了高速、實時、識別率高的要求。關(guān)鍵詞:DM642;CIS;圖像處理;FPGA1.引言在銀行業(yè)務(wù)當(dāng)中,紙幣清分是一項重要業(yè)務(wù),其中包括殘損識別、缺角識別、新舊判斷、污漬識別及號碼識別等。據(jù)了解目前國內(nèi)較

2、多銀行使用的紙幣清分機(jī)都是從國外進(jìn)口的,成本較高。國產(chǎn)紙幣清分機(jī)相對較少,而且功能都很有限,很難滿足高速實時性的要求,尤其是能夠用圖像處理的方法來識別紙幣的紙幣清分機(jī)還剛剛起步。更何況有不少清分機(jī)的圖像處理部分由工控機(jī)完成,體積較大,為此,設(shè)計了一種基于DSP處理芯片的紙幣識別系統(tǒng)。該系統(tǒng)以DSP為核心處理器,結(jié)合接觸式圖像傳感器CIS和可編程邏輯門陣列FPGA,并輔以高性能的模/數(shù)轉(zhuǎn)換器AD9822,進(jìn)行紙幣圖像的采集、轉(zhuǎn)換及處理。該系統(tǒng)除了針對人民幣99版和05版的5元、10元、20元、50元、100元

3、紙幣進(jìn)行識別外,只要將FLASH中的紙幣模板換成其他外幣圖像模板(如歐元、臺幣、港幣及奧幣等),同樣可將其正確識別。利用數(shù)字圖像處理技術(shù)及模板匹配算法識別紙幣圖像的長度、寬度、方向塊特征,區(qū)分紙幣的面值、正反面與正反向。最終完成的系統(tǒng)能達(dá)到較高的識別速度和識別率。2.硬件設(shè)計識別系統(tǒng)的總體硬件結(jié)構(gòu)如圖1所示。紙幣圖像首先通過傳感器CIS掃描后得到光電轉(zhuǎn)換信號,然后將模擬信號經(jīng)過模數(shù)轉(zhuǎn)換器AD9822轉(zhuǎn)換成為標(biāo)準(zhǔn)的數(shù)字信號經(jīng)DSP的VP口送入到VP緩沖區(qū)中;最后通過EDMA通道輸入到DSP的RAM中,在DSP

4、中進(jìn)行圖像的處理和識別。整個系統(tǒng)的信號邏輯時序由FPGA來控制。圖1識別系統(tǒng)的總體硬件結(jié)構(gòu)框圖紙幣圖像的采集由CIS與A/D轉(zhuǎn)換器組成。本系統(tǒng)采用線型CIS,它的采樣速度較快、電路設(shè)計比較簡單、體積小、時序也易于實現(xiàn)。每張圖像的像素為864×400。紙幣的進(jìn)入判斷使用紅外對管檢測,每張紙幣采集指定行數(shù)如400行,利用FPGA的內(nèi)部時鐘記數(shù)器完成一張紙幣的結(jié)束采集,如400×1000個時間采一幅紙幣圖像。紙幣圖像經(jīng)過采集和A/D轉(zhuǎn)換后,暫存入DSP的圖像緩沖區(qū)中,然后由DSP通過EDMA通道直接傳輸。整個采集

5、和存儲過程的時序信號是由EP1C6Q240C8產(chǎn)生的。圖像的識別部分由數(shù)字信號處理器DSP及相應(yīng)的外圍電路構(gòu)成,其結(jié)構(gòu)如圖2所示。數(shù)字信號處理器DSP選用TI公司生產(chǎn)的DM642芯片,主頻為600MHz。掃描采集到的紙幣圖像數(shù)據(jù)Data經(jīng)EDMA存入靜態(tài)存儲器SDRAM中,DSP對已存入SDRAM的數(shù)據(jù)作一系列的識別算法運(yùn)算,并將最終結(jié)果通過DSP的VP2口輸出(VP2模擬串口輸出數(shù)據(jù))?!  D2DSP及相應(yīng)的外圍電路的結(jié)構(gòu)圖3.圖像的搜邊、矯正、面值與方向算法處理  圖像的搜邊矯正包括兩個方面:圖像邊界

6、及中心點(diǎn)的確定和圖像傾斜度的校正。求取圖像邊界中心點(diǎn)的方法,采用自整個掃描的圖像邊界向內(nèi)選取,確定紙幣圖像邊界上的少數(shù)點(diǎn),再對這些點(diǎn)進(jìn)行直線擬合,從而確定紙幣的四個邊界。四個邊界中心點(diǎn)的連線的交點(diǎn)即為圖像的中心點(diǎn)。紙幣圖像的邊界與掃描采集的圖像的邊界的夾角就是傾斜角。將傾斜角超過20°的紙幣不作處理,作為不可識別類送向清分機(jī)指定鈔口。  確定了紙幣圖像的邊界、中心點(diǎn)和傾斜角后,紙幣的長度和寬度就能準(zhǔn)確地計算出來。在檢測中對于長寬差異小的人民幣(比如99版5元與05版50元),則提取圖像的區(qū)域特征加以區(qū)分比較

7、,判別面值。下面是經(jīng)DSP的內(nèi)聯(lián)函數(shù)優(yōu)化后的圖像矯正算法代碼:  voidImageUST_ITERATE(320);  for(j=0;j<dstS320DM642DigitalMediaProcessor[EB/OL].TI,2003.[4]侯伯亨,顧新.VHDL硬件描述語言與數(shù)字邏輯電路設(shè)計[M].西安:西安電子科技大學(xué)出版,1999

當(dāng)前文檔最多預(yù)覽五頁,下載文檔查看全文

此文檔下載收益歸作者所有

當(dāng)前文檔最多預(yù)覽五頁,下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學(xué)公式或PPT動畫的文件,查看預(yù)覽時可能會顯示錯亂或異常,文件下載后無此問題,請放心下載。
2. 本文檔由用戶上傳,版權(quán)歸屬用戶,天天文庫負(fù)責(zé)整理代發(fā)布。如果您對本文檔版權(quán)有爭議請及時聯(lián)系客服。
3. 下載前請仔細(xì)閱讀文檔內(nèi)容,確認(rèn)文檔內(nèi)容符合您的需求后進(jìn)行下載,若出現(xiàn)內(nèi)容與標(biāo)題不符可向本站投訴處理。
4. 下載文檔時可能由于網(wǎng)絡(luò)波動等原因無法下載或下載錯誤,付費(fèi)完成后未能成功下載的用戶請聯(lián)系客服處理。